Output 6dd351ac48a5c367ff66ee59ac5657a93dfce1a15dda8de4a4e61314b33f124f:21

value
88623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d8cc9fc6ac83eb542885a61cbe5b477b021675a OP_EQUAL
address
3D8s3iPCp8CuMfqDrD6kaGoVKu2dbs294d
transaction
6dd351ac48a5c367ff66ee59ac5657a93dfce1a15dda8de4a4e61314b33f124f
spent
true